War rages, but the women and children of Liverpools Dr Barnardos Home cannot give up hope.
LIVERPOOL, 1943
Yorkshire is the place Lana has always called home, but its now filled with painful memories of her fiance, Dickie, who was killed at sea. When she accepts the challenging position of headmistress at a school in Liverpool, she hopes a new beginning will help to mend her broken heart.
A BATTLE TO FIGHT
Not everyone at Bingham School is happy about her arrival but Lana throws herself into the role, teaching children from the local village and the nearby Dr Barnardos orphanage. She thrives in her work, but soon finds herself falling for a man who she would once have considered the enemy and is torn between what she knows is right, and taking a risk that might see her lose everything.
THE STRENGTH TO HOPE
There are children that desperately need her help, and Lana must fight for everyones happiness, as well as her own. But one young girl in particular shows her that there is a way through the darkness because even when all seems lost, there is always a glimmer of hope to be found...
